Update on search for missing man - Broken Head
Friday, 28 March 2025 03:42:36 PM
The coordinated multi-agency search for a missing 45-year-old man at Broken Head on the Far North Coast has been suspended.
The search began on Tuesday 25 March 2025 by Tweed/Byron Police supported by Police Rescue, Marine Area Command, Queensland Police Service, NSW National Parks and Wildlife Service, Surf Life Saving NSW, NSW SES, and Marine Rescue NSW.
The search continued during daylight hours until 1pm this afternoon (Friday 28 March 2025), when it was suspended.
While the multi-agency coordinated search has been suspended, taskings by local police and Marine Area Command will continue in the area over coming days.
Police wish to thank those who volunteered in the search for the missing man and the local community for their support.
